Abstract
A type of dimethyl disulfide gas CRM in the ppb level was developed for the analysis of tracelevel odorous gas in environmental atmosphere. The concentration of dimethyl disulfide($(CH_3)_2S_2$) was $10{\mu}mol/mol$ level in the cylinder filled with nitrogen, 1500 psi. And the variability of the concentration for 2 years was about 0.14% due to the adsorption or instability of $(CH_3)_2S_2$. The gas standards produced simultaneously in 4 bottles and examined by GC-FID were shown with 0.4%, reproducibility of preparation and 0.25%, standard uncertainty due to weighing and purity.
